Navigating the ETF Landscape: A Guide for Beginners
Embarking on your investment journey can appear overwhelming, particularly when confronted with the diverse world of exchange-traded funds (ETFs). These flexible investment vehicles offer a convenient way to access exposure to various asset classes, from stocks and bonds to commodities and real estate. Nonetheless, navigating the vast ETF landscape can be challenging for investors. This guide aims to cast light on the fundamentals of ETFs, empowering you to formulate informed investment decisions.
- First, it's essential to understand what an ETF is and how it operates.
- Next, consider your financial goals and risk tolerance.
- Lastly, investigate different ETFs meticulously to identify those that align with your objectives.
By adhering to these steps, you can confidently navigate the ETF landscape and position yourself for ongoing investment success.
US ETFs vs. Canadian ETFs: Which is Right for You?
When it comes to investing,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) offer a flexible way to expand your portfolio. Nevertheless, choosing between US and Canadian ETFs can be challenging. Both present a wide range of trading options, but there are some key differences to consider. Canadian ETFs, on the other hand, are typically known for their reduced expense ratios and robust performance in certain sectors. Ultimately, the best choice for you will depend on your personal investment goals, risk tolerance, and tax situation.
- Evaluate your investment horizon and risk appetite.
- Explore the expense ratios and performance history of different ETFs.
- Spread your investments across multiple asset classes and sectors.
By carefully evaluating these factors, you can make an well-researched decision about which type of ETF is suitable for your portfolio.
